I. Product Overview: Introduction to the ST STA8600ASP Teseo VI Quad-Frequency GNSS Single-Chip
The STA8600ASP is a quad-frequency GNSS receiver IC within ST’s Teseo VI family, featuring an embedded RTK algorithm and a hardware security module (HSM). The chip integrates a dual-core Arm® Cortex®‑M7 processor, RF front-end, baseband processing engine and embedded phase-change memory (PCM) onto a single die. It requires no external Flash memory and can independently perform multi-frequency raw measurements and centimetre-level RTK processing.
The STA8600ASP integrates a Hardware Security Module (HSM) microcontroller to support secure boot. Combined with signal and interface integrity mechanisms, this makes the STA8600A an ideal choice for applications with extremely high integrity requirements. It supports highly advanced anti-jamming and anti-spoofing mechanisms, mitigating attacks through independent L5 signal acquisition and tracking, as well as Galileo OSNMA functionality. Its innovative RF architecture and GNSS baseband design enable it to support emerging Low Earth Orbit (LEO) constellations.
II. STA8600ASP Key Specifications
GNSS Bands: Quad-frequency simultaneous reception: L1 / L2 / L5 / E6 (E5a/b), BeiDou B1/B2a/B3, etc.
Supported constellations: GPS (L1C/A + L2C + L5), Galileo (E1 + E5a + E5b), GLONASS, BeiDou (B1I + B2a + B3I), QZSS, NavIC (IRNSS)
Tracking channels: 192 (96 data channels + 96 pilot channels)
Positioning accuracy: Standard PVT sub-metre level; centimetre-level accuracy achievable with embedded RTK (STA8600ASP exclusive)
Measurement outputs: Code phase, carrier phase, Doppler frequency
Processor: Dual-core Arm Cortex‑M7, with built-in RAM / NVM / Cache
Storage: Embedded phase-change memory (PCM), no external Flash required
Track estimation: Supports TESEO‑DRAW (with vehicle speed sensor) and Teseo‑DRUM (without vehicle speed sensor) modes
Security Features: Integrated HSM – secure boot, secure firmware updates, secure link; anti-jamming/anti-spoofing; Galileo OSNMA
Communication Interfaces: 2×UART (with hardware flow control), 1×SSP, 1×I²C, 1×SPIQ, 2×PPS I/O
Power Domains: Backup domain 1.71–3.63 V; Switchable domain 1.71–3.63 V; Optional external core voltage 0.9–1.0 V
ESD: HBM 2 kV / CDM 500 V
Operating Temperature: –40 °C to +105 °C (automotive grade)
III. Key Features of the STA8600ASP
1. High-Precision Positioning with Four Frequencies and Six Constellations
The STA8600ASP supports the simultaneous reception and processing of signals from six global navigation satellite systems (GPS, Galileo, GLONASS, BeiDou, QZSS and NAVIC), covering the four frequency bands L1, L2, L5 and E6. This multi-frequency reception capability effectively eliminates ionospheric errors, achieving sub-metre standard PVT positioning accuracy.
2. Embedded RTK Centimetre-Level Precision Positioning
The STA8600AP and STA8600ASP models feature built-in RTK (Real-Time Kinematic) precision positioning algorithms, enabling centimetre-level positioning accuracy without the need for an external host device. This feature makes them particularly suitable for applications requiring extremely high positioning accuracy, such as drones, robotic lawnmowers and precision agriculture equipment.
3. Continuous positioning in GNSS dead zones
Supporting TESEO-DRAW (Trajectory-based Automotive Positioning) and Teseo-DRUM (Trajectory-based Offline Mode), the system maintains continuous high-precision positioning through inertial sensor fusion even in environments where satellite signals are obstructed, such as tunnels, underground car parks and urban canyons.
4. Highly Integrated SoC Architecture
The chip features two independent Arm® Cortex®-M7 processor cores, with sufficient MIPS and memory resources to support the direct on-chip execution of quad-frequency algorithms. Utilising STMicroelectronics’ proprietary phase-change memory (PCM) technology, it eliminates the need for external Flash memory, effectively simplifying design, reducing BOM costs and minimising supply chain constraints.
5. Comprehensive Security Protection
The STA8600ASP integrates a Hardware Security Module (HSM), supporting secure boot, secure firmware updates and secure connections, and complies with the ISO/SAE 21434 automotive cybersecurity standard. It also features advanced anti-jamming and anti-spoofing mechanisms, effectively defending against various types of attacks through independent L5 signal acquisition and tracking, as well as Galileo OSNMA functionality.
6. Future-Proof Architecture
Its innovative RF architecture and GNSS baseband design enable reception of signals from emerging Low Earth Orbit (LEO) navigation constellations, providing ample scope for future navigation technology evolution.
